Understanding the Core Mechanics

At its heart, the chicken road game is remarkably straightforward. Players control a chicken attempting to cross a road filled with varying levels of traffic. The goal is to navigate the chicken safely from one side to the other without colliding with any vehicles. Each successful crossing awards points, and the difficulty often increases with time, featuring faster traffic and more obstacles. The success relies heavily on timing – knowing exactly when to move the chicken forward and when to pause to avoid oncoming cars, trucks, or other hazards. Factors such as screen responsiveness, the chicken’s movement speed, and the density of traffic all influence the player’s ability to succeed.

Strategic Approaches to Mastering the Game

While luck plays a minor role, skillful play is paramount in achieving high scores in the chicken road game. One common strategy involves identifying patterns in the traffic flow. Observing the gaps between cars and anticipating their movements allows players to time their crossings more effectively. Furthermore, some skilled players adopt a ‘pulse’ approach, quickly tapping to avoid a steady stream of traffic. Learning to respond swiftly to unexpected obstacles is also crucial, often requiring split-second decisions and precise control. Mastering the game isn’t simply about reaction time, but also about developing a predictive capacity.

Power-Ups and Their Strategic Use

Many iterations of the chicken road game include power-ups. These can range from temporary invincibility to speed boosts and coin multipliers. Knowing when and how to use them strategically can significantly improve your score. Using an invincibility power-up during a period of intense traffic, for example, can allow you to safely navigate a particularly challenging section of the road. Similarly, activating a coin multiplier when crossing a lane with numerous collectible items can boost your earnings. Efficient power-up management is undoubtedly a key aspect of maximizing your score and conquering the leaderboard.
